@Repository public interface BudgetingGroupRepository extends org.springframework.data.jpa.repository.JpaRepository<BudgetGroup,Long>
| Modifier and Type | Method and Description |
|---|---|
List<BudgetGroup> |
findBudgetGroupByNameLike(String name) |
List<BudgetGroup> |
findByAccountTypeIs(String accountType) |
List<BudgetGroup> |
findBybudgetingTypeIs(String budgetingType) |
List<BudgetGroup> |
findByIsActiveTrue() |
BudgetGroup |
findByMajorCode_Id(Long id) |
BudgetGroup |
findByMajorCode_IdAndIdNotIn(Long majorCodeId,
Long id) |
List<BudgetGroup> |
findByMinCodeGlcodeLessThanEqualAndMaxCodeGlcodeGreaterThanEqual(String minCode,
String minCode1) |
List<BudgetGroup> |
findByMinCodeGlcodeLessThanEqualAndMaxCodeGlcodeGreaterThanEqualAndIdNotIn(String minCode,
String minCode1,
Long id) |
List<org.egov.commons.CChartOfAccounts> |
findCOAByLength(Integer length) |
List<BudgetGroup> |
getBudgetGroupForMappedMajorCode(Integer length,
String majorCode) |
BudgetGroup |
getBudgetGroupForMinorCodesMajorCode(String minCode) |
deleteAllInBatch, deleteInBatch, findAll, findAll, findAll, findAll, findAll, flush, getOne, save, saveAndFlushfindAllBudgetGroup findByMajorCode_Id(Long id)
BudgetGroup findByMajorCode_IdAndIdNotIn(Long majorCodeId, Long id)
List<BudgetGroup> findByMinCodeGlcodeLessThanEqualAndMaxCodeGlcodeGreaterThanEqual(String minCode, String minCode1)
List<BudgetGroup> findByMinCodeGlcodeLessThanEqualAndMaxCodeGlcodeGreaterThanEqualAndIdNotIn(String minCode, String minCode1, Long id)
@Query(value="from BudgetGroup where upper(name) like \'%\'||upper(:name)||\'%\' order by id") List<BudgetGroup> findBudgetGroupByNameLike(@Param(value="name") String name)
@Query(value="from BudgetGroup where substr(minCode.glcode,1,:length)<=:majorCode and substr(maxCode.glcode,1,:length)>=:majorCode") List<BudgetGroup> getBudgetGroupForMappedMajorCode(@Param(value="length") Integer length, @Param(value="majorCode") String majorCode)
@Query(value="from BudgetGroup where majorCode.glcode<=:minCode and majorCode.glcode>=:minCode") BudgetGroup getBudgetGroupForMinorCodesMajorCode(@Param(value="minCode") String minCode)
@Query(value="from CChartOfAccounts where length(glcode)=:length order by glcode") List<org.egov.commons.CChartOfAccounts> findCOAByLength(@Param(value="length") Integer length)
List<BudgetGroup> findByAccountTypeIs(String accountType)
List<BudgetGroup> findBybudgetingTypeIs(String budgetingType)
List<BudgetGroup> findByIsActiveTrue()
Copyright © 2015–2017 eGovernments Foundation. All rights reserved.